As much as I hate to appear to be complaining, I think that it should be more along the lines of constructive criticism.
Yes, puunjab is correct, but very inflammatory and defeating the purpose of trying to figure out the problem.
Was the problem, not in the patch, but the preamp? or recorder levels?
Is there a setting that will do an automatic +4 or +10db, professional gear has that. This helps to control the gain structure and account for differences in the cables used.
I think that the problem here is the lineage stated as:
XLR -> ? -> RCA -> Nomad
between the xlr and the rca, needs to be a "DI-Box" It resolves all the line levels and provides a consistant output of data.
Anytime I mix pro wiring with consumer wiring I use mt DI-Box, since it is rare to get the sbd patch, it is equally rare that you bring a DI-Box with you...
I have been taking multiple mics with me to see what I can do depending on the space, so with it, I bring one of those Behringer Euro Mixer, it is powered with 9V Batteries and accepts XLR and 1/4", which are the profesional cables, the outputs are many, there are the xlr, 1/4", digital coax and rca, this also is capable of providing the current needed to keep a constant 48Volts to the mics...
I am sure that there is a portable DI-Box available in the $50 range and I don't think that there are any real expensive ones because this problem is associated with the Proffesional meets the Amateur and that is an unusual happening.
If you don't get a di-box, check out some of the cables that are custom made. They vary as your situation, but it is rather easy to get an XLR -> 1/4" or RCA, I certainly can say for sure that in my bag of tricks are numerious converters, all are 2" long, stainless steel and are made to convert XLR to any other cable. For $12 each, you could get an XLR F-> RCA F, I think that is right (the M/F).
I bring them with me always as they take little space and are very handy.
To me, that is the problem here. The xlr feed was juiced, as it is supposed to be, but there was no buffer between to reduce the juice.
I think that this is a live and learn thing, that it can be a valuable asset to understand this stuff next time you get a sbd feed.
As always the effort is appreciated, but, to be honest, this should have been picked out immediately after the transfer. I hate to say, but it seems to fit the situation...
To take your recording and to seed the transfer, knowing the magnitude of the distortion is careless, at the least.
This same thing happened to me one time when I was using a sound designs mix-pre -> marantz CF recorder. I was happy to see the xlr into the preamp and out to the marantz, but the first recording resulted in this exact same static.
I learned that if I was using an external preamp, I needed to use the 1/8" input on the recorder. So I had to buy a custom 2-xlr -> 1-1/8" stereo mini. Sounds bad, but it made all the difference. the recordings using that are fantastic.
The issue was that I was juicing the mics with the preamp and the levels were set on the preamp, I just set them real low on the marantz, but that will not work, the xlr needs an appropriate conversion to consumer levels. This is with the all in one 722's and such, that is different as it is all in one box, but $5,000...
Anyway, that would be my take on this and suggestion for future reference. It's a shame, there is a really nice low end shelf that rocks, but the louder you play it, the worse it gets...
